1.5 Anatomy of a cell

1.5 Anatomy of a Cell (17:39)

All cancers begin in cells, the basic building blocks of the human body. This lecture describes the structure and key components of human cells and introduces concepts that play important roles in cancer diagnosis and treatment. The video ends by showing examples of how cells look under the microscope when studied by cancer scientists.

Presenter: Michael C. Ostrowski, PhD, professor of Molecular Virology, Immunology and Medical Genetics, and co-leader of the OSUCCC – James Molecular Biology and Cancer Genetics Program
